The 1881 Census reveals a detailed snapshot of households in England, Wales and Scotland. The census was taken on April 3rd and the total population was recorded as 29,707,207.

In the 1881 Census, the household of Michael Ferrie, born in 1843 in , consisted of 3 members. Michael was the head of the household, married to Margaret Ferrie, born in 1840 in Cardross, Dunbartonshire, Scotland. They had 1 child; Walter, born 1877 in Glasgow, Lanarkshire, Scotland.
